This unit is designed to grind concentrates so
you can test your Black Sands for hidden values, to make an
excellent Quantitive, Scorification or Amalgamation Mill. If you
want, you can run a sample batch from 1 ounce to 5 lbs at one
time. If you have tried to pick up small flakes or flour gold in
a gold pan with the aid of mercury but no luck in picking up up
gold, silver and platinum just because it had a little grease
that could come from a number of sources ... this can, in many
cases, be remedied by just adding a little dishwashing detergent
to the water. Sometimes the Black Sands are
magnetic, some are not. There are many other elements that gold,
silver and platinum will cling to. Over a period of time, some
elements will coat the above metals will stop the mercury from
catching these values. The remedy in most cases is just the fact
that you will have to scrub or scour the Black sands in the
Amalgamation Mill. It will break out these hidden values and
clean so that the mercury can amalgamate with them. An
example is to take fist size Quartz rock ( 2 to 3 lbs) and
broken it down with a crusher (or in a mortar and pestle) to
above 1/4" or finer ... then ground the quartz material to
200 to 300 mesh in about 3 to 4 minutes with no work to speak
of. The Amalgamation Mill can be put in series or
in a battery and will provide a really good Pilot Plant and will
process material in 5 lb batches up to 100 lb per hour for
concentrates or raw ore. The Amalgamation Mill
requires a 1/4 HP Electric Motor (not included). The pulleys
reduce the speed from 1725
rpm
to approximately 60
revolutions
per
minute.
The unit can be mounted very easily to any type of base or
bench.Bowl:
240 mm Diameter x 130 mm High. Weight: 15 kg. 3
Ball Grinder: Weight: 9 kg WEIGHT
for Bowl & 3 Ball Grinder = 24 kg Pulleys
& Brackets: Weight approximately 6 kg OVERALL
WEIGHT = (approximately) 30 kg APPROXIMATE
OVERALL SIZE REQUIRED FOR USE IS: 700 mm x 400
mm
